Behr Moss Stone (PPU7-01) is a sophisticated, earthy neutral that exudes warmth and timeless elegance. This shade is a harmonious blend of gray and green, reminiscent of natural stone and lush moss found in serene landscapes. Its rich, muted tone makes it a versatile choice for both traditional and contemporary spaces, creating an inviting and grounded atmosphere wherever it’s used.
The beauty of Moss Stone lies in its complex undertones. It carries subtle green hues that are balanced by a soft gray base, giving it a natural, organic character. The green undertones are not overly pronounced, making this color a refined choice for those who want to incorporate a hint of nature without overwhelming the space. Depending on the lighting, Moss Stone can appear cooler or warmer, adapting to the mood of the room. In spaces with natural light, the green undertones become more prominent, while in dimly lit areas, the gray tones take center stage, offering a cozy and subdued aesthetic.

Moss Stone’s adaptability makes it an excellent choice for a variety of interior and exterior applications. Here are some ways to incorporate this shade into your home:
Transform your living room into a tranquil retreat by using Moss Stone on the walls. Its neutral undertones make it an excellent backdrop for furniture and décor in both warm and cool tones. Pair it with plush textiles, wooden accents, and greenery to enhance its organic appeal.
In bedrooms, Moss Stone creates a soothing and restful vibe. Paint all four walls for an enveloping effect, or use it as an accent wall behind the bed. Complement it with soft linens in ivory or sage green to complete the look.
Give your kitchen or dining area a modern yet cozy feel by incorporating Moss Stone on cabinetry or walls. Pair it with white countertops and brass hardware for a sophisticated contrast, or add natural wood finishes for a rustic charm.
In bathrooms, Moss Stone works beautifully as a wall color or on cabinetry. Its muted tones lend a spa-like ambiance, especially when paired with white subway tiles, natural stone, and greenery.
Moss Stone is also an excellent choice for exteriors, offering a timeless and earthy look. Use it on siding, shutters, or trim, and pair it with crisp whites or deep browns for a classic curb appeal.
When choosing Moss Stone, it’s essential to consider the lighting in your space. Natural light will enhance its green undertones, while artificial or dim lighting will bring out its gray hues. To ensure it works well in your room, test the color on your walls at different times of the day.
